Somnigroup International Inc. (SGI)
Cash conversion cycle
Sep 30, 2024 | Jun 30, 2024 | Mar 31, 2024 | Dec 31, 2023 | Sep 30, 2023 | Jun 30, 2023 | Mar 31, 2023 | Dec 31, 2022 | Sep 30, 2022 | Jun 30, 2022 | Mar 31, 2022 | Dec 31, 2021 | Sep 30, 2021 | Jun 30, 2021 | Mar 31, 2021 | Dec 31, 2020 | Sep 30, 2020 | Jun 30, 2020 | Mar 31, 2020 | Dec 31, 2019 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Days of inventory on hand (DOH) | days | 66.49 | 68.16 | 64.62 | 63.05 | 62.46 | 67.17 | 72.25 | 70.54 | 74.66 | 76.15 | 73.07 | 61.08 | 54.27 | 49.11 | 53.92 | 55.88 | 51.54 | 52.19 | 54.83 | 53.91 |
Days of sales outstanding (DSO) | days | 34.88 | 35.52 | 35.97 | 33.81 | 38.83 | 35.12 | 34.45 | 31.34 | 34.99 | 34.01 | 30.36 | 31.05 | 40.24 | 38.35 | 37.21 | 38.09 | 46.09 | 39.23 | 42.03 | 43.72 |
Number of days of payables | days | 46.47 | 47.46 | 45.56 | 40.63 | 46.53 | 46.02 | 46.93 | 45.73 | 54.87 | 53.21 | 58.11 | 56.88 | 65.34 | 52.52 | 47.12 | 58.03 | 61.89 | 49.83 | 53.21 | 52.09 |
Cash conversion cycle | days | 54.90 | 56.22 | 55.03 | 56.23 | 54.76 | 56.27 | 59.77 | 56.16 | 54.78 | 56.95 | 45.32 | 35.25 | 29.17 | 34.94 | 44.01 | 35.94 | 35.74 | 41.59 | 43.65 | 45.54 |
September 30, 2024 calculation
Cash conversion cycle = DOH + DSO – Number of days of payables
= 66.49 + 34.88 – 46.47
= 54.90
The cash conversion cycle is a critical metric that reflects how efficiently a company manages its working capital. For Somnigroup International Inc., we observe fluctuations in its cash conversion cycle over the indicated time periods from December 31, 2019, to September 30, 2024.
Initially, the company's cash conversion cycle decreased from 45.54 days on December 31, 2019, to 29.17 days on September 30, 2021, indicating an improvement in efficiency in converting its resources into cash. During this period, the company was able to manage its receivables, inventory, and payables more effectively.
However, there was an upward trend in the cash conversion cycle from March 31, 2022, reaching a peak of 59.77 days on March 31, 2023. This increase suggests potential challenges in managing working capital efficiently during this period. The company might have faced difficulties in optimizing its cash inflows and outflows, impacting its overall liquidity position.
Subsequently, there was a slight improvement in the cash conversion cycle, stabilizing around 54-56 days from June 30, 2023, to September 30, 2024. While the company managed to mitigate the increase seen in early 2022-2023, it still operates with a longer cash conversion cycle compared to the more efficient levels observed in 2020-2021.
